/MusicRecommendationAlgorithm

Algorithm for Music Recommendation System in JLU Comprehensive Practice of Software Development.

Primary LanguagePythonMIT LicenseMIT

MusicRecommendationAlgorithm

Algorithm for Music Recommendation System in JLU Comprehensive Practice of Software Development.

Our Algorithm is mainly based on Collaborative Filtering(CF). It is composed of 3 parts: User-based CF, Item-based CF and Latent Factor Model.

UserCF & ItemCF are implemented in CollaborativeFiltering.py, while LFM is implemented in MatrixDecomposition.py.

More illustration can be found in the PPT.